+The approach I've been using for a given header is to recursively do each
+of the "bits" headers which make up the standard header. So, e.g., while
+there are four headers making up <algorithm>, three of them were already
+documented in the course of doing other headers.
+
+"Untouched" means I've deliberately skipped it for various reasons, or
+haven't gotten to it yet. It /will/ be done (by somebody, eventually.)
+
+If you document an area and need to skip (for whatever reason) a non-trivial
+entity (i.e., one that should be documented), go ahead and add the comment
+markup, and use the homegrown @doctodo tag. See include/bits/stl_iterator.h
+for examples of this. Doing so will at least cause doxygen to consider the
+entitiy as documented and include it in the output. It will also add the
+entity to the generated TODO page.

+NOTES:
+
+A) So far I have not tried to document any of the <c*> headers. So entities
+such as atexit() are undocumented throughout the library. Since we usually
+do not have the C code (to which the doxygen comments would be attached),
+this would need to be done in entirely separate files, a la doxygroups.cc.
+
+B) Huge chunks of containers and strings are described in common "Tables"
+in the standard. These are pseudo-duplicated in tables.html. We can
+use doxygen hooks like @pre and @see to reference the tables. Then the
+individual classes do like the standard does, and only document members for
+which additional info is available.
+
+
+STYLE:
+stl_deque.h, stl_pair.h, and stl_algobase.h have good examples of what I've
+been using for class, namespace-scope, and function documentation, respectively.
+These should serve as starting points. /Please/ maintain the inter-word and
+inter-sentence spacing, as this might be generated and/or scanned in the
+future.
